UNE, Curry end regular season with 0-0 draw


Box Score

MILTON, Mass. -- Both the University of New England and Curry College ended their regular seasons on Tuesday (Oct. 28), playing to a 0-0 double-overtime tie in a Commonwealth Coast Conference women's soccer match at Walter M. Katz Field.

The Nor'easters now stand at 11-3-2 (5-2-2 CCC) heading into the playoffs, while Curry is 11-6-2 (1-6-2 CCC) and awaits word on a potential ECAC bid.

UNE doubled-up the Colonels in shots, 26-13, and also had four corner kicks compared to zero for the Colonels. Brielle Robinson needed seven saves to register her second shutout of the season for Big Blue. She had a pair of diving stops in the second half to help force overtime.

Morgan Stott offered an impressive performance in goal for the Colonels, turning aside a career-best 19 shots, including eight during the extra periods.

The Nor'easters are seeded fourth for the CCC Championship and will host No. 5 Gordon College at Barbara J. Hazard Field on Saturday at noon. The Fighting Scots took a 2-0 win over UNE on Sept. 20 in the regular-season meeting between the two teams. The championship continues with the semifinal round Nov. 4 and the title game on Nov. 8.
